Solar lamps for a project in Tanzania

On 23 May 2011, Joseph Sekiku from the Tanzanian organization FADECO visited our workshop in the Hildesheim Technology Centre together with Thomas Sklorz. As previously reported, we produce solar lamps from industrial waste there.

In his search for support for Sekiku’s diverse activities in Tanzania, Sklorz came across Arbeit und Dritte Welt. During his first visit to us in Stadtfeld almost three weeks ago, Sekiku saw the easily rebuildable solar lamps and was delighted.
After workshop manager Peter Wein had explained the design and manufacturing principle of our lamps, we considered the steps of a collaboration.

We want to send FADECO a complete set for the production of solar lamps. Among other things, we want to use the prize money we received from dm this year for our solar project. Sekiku wants to learn how to build the lamps in our workshop next week and then train two young people in Tanzania.

The proceeds from the sale of the lamps will be used to accumulate capital for further aid shipments.
